Any cigar smoker knows, when you go to Las Vegas, the “holy grail” of cigars is Casa Fuente.  I go to Vegas fairly often, but I have yet to do a review of Casa Fuente.  I did not get any pictures, as I was busy smoking a cigar and drinking a beer to take any pictures.  On to the review…

The Casa Fuente Cigar shop is a shop dedicated to all Fuente products, from Opus, to Ashton, and everything in between that is manufactured by Fuente.  The great thing about this particular store is that they carry every rare Fuente product you can imagine.  From the Opus X Forbidden X and the Opus Chili Pepper, to the seasonal release of Anejo’s, they have it all.  Be prepared to spend some heavy $$ there if you REALLY want to enjoy yourself.  This time around, I bought myself a God Of Fire, and one of their trusty Mojitos to start with.  The cigar was $35.00 and the Mojito was $12.00.  After those were over, I opted to pick up a Casa Fuente house Corona (this is the ONLY place you can get these cigars, with the exception of one other place online, that I don’t think is supposed to sell them) for $18.00 and a Newcastle draft, of which I cannot recall the price.  The cigar and drink choices are excellent, and the staff are friendly, and not to mention, the waitresses are smokin!

Another thing that Casa Fuente is known for is their great collection of cigar paraphernalia. They have some very nice Opus X Dupont lighters, and the famous Cigar in a bottle of liquor.   I don’t recall what the liquor is, but for some reason I want to say its scotch.  Anyone that is a cigar smoker who goes to Vegas needs to visit Casa Fuente at least once during their trip.  Sit out on the patio, smoke a cigar, and have a nice drink.  There is nothing more relaxing, and the smokes and drinks are all top notch.  I am in vegas at least 4-5 times a year, and every time, I hit up Casa Fuente, because it is in fact very enjoyable.

Being that I just started up this blog, I thought it appropriate to review my home cigar shop for the first post in this blog.

My home cigar lounge is “The Humidor” at 12 E. Vine St, Redlands, Ca.  There is a nice lounge area with 4 huge leather chairs, and 2 flat screen televisions.  The “regulars” there are just like family to me.  The selection of cigars is one of the best I have seen in the inland empire, and the prices are very good in comparison to the rest of california.  We often spend many an hour playing darts, poker, or just shootin the breeze.  The cigars are kept in the highest quality conditions and the variety is outstanding.  You will be able to find a cigar for anyone.  From $2.00-30.00 per stick, no matter your budget, you can find something at “The Humidor” that you will enjoy.  There are also many events and a monthly poker tournament that take place at the shop.  The owners, Tim Hughes and Terry Dickey are two of the coolest people you’ll ever meet, with a real drive to see their shop succeed.  I love every day I spend there, and I hope it doesn’t change.  If you are ever in Southern California, a stop at “The Humidor” should be considered manditory!
